虚拟主机网页压缩技巧分享
虚拟主机是一种共享服务器资源的方式,允许多个用户在同一台物理服务器上运行独立的应用程序,网页压缩技术可以帮助减轻网站在传输过程中产生的带宽消耗,提高页面加载速度,通过使用合适的压缩算法和工具对静态文件进行压缩,可以有效减少数据量,提升用户体验,还可以结合缓存机制来进一步优化性能,总体而言,合理的网页压缩策略对于提高网站整体效率至关重要。
提升用户体验与节省资源
在互联网时代,网站已经成为企业和个人展示自我和获取信息的重要平台,为了提供更快、更稳定的在线服务,虚拟主机成为许多网站托管的理想选择,随着访问量的不断增加,服务器负载也随之上升,如何有效优化网页性能成为一个关键问题,本文将探讨虚拟主机中网页压缩的应用及其对用户体验和资源消耗的影响。
什么是网页压缩?
网页压缩是指通过技术手段减少网页文件大小的过程,这种做法涉及去除冗余数据、使用较小的文件格式(例如GIF、JPEG)以及利用图像优化工具等方法,这些措施不仅可以减小上传到服务器的数据量,还能显著提高网页加载速度,从而改善用户的浏览体验。
为什么需要在虚拟主机上进行网页压缩?
- 减轻服务器负担: 通过网页压缩,可以显著减少上传到服务器的数据量,有助于降低服务器的CPU和内存压力。
- 加速网页加载: 压缩后的网页文件体积变小,意味着网络传输时间缩短,提高了用户的访问速度。
- 节约带宽成本: 较少的数据传输可以减少网络流量需求,进而降低带宽费用,为企业节省开支。
虚拟主机中实现网页压缩的方法
-
使用CDN服务:
CDN(Content Delivery Network)是一种分布式的存储系统,能够在全球范围内分发内容,使得同一份内容可以在多个边缘节点缓存,这对静态文件尤其重要,因为它们通常会被反复访问,通过使用CDN,可以大大减少服务器端的请求次数,从而提升整体性能。
-
浏览器缓存:
部分浏览器支持HTTP/2协议,它允许客户端缓存静态资源,减少每次请求所需的带宽和处理时间,对于那些不支持HTTP/2的浏览器,可以考虑使用CDN来缓存网页内容,以提高加载速度。
-
应用层压缩:
在应用程序层面实施压缩技术,比如使用JavaScript库或框架内置的压缩功能,或者借助第三方库如Gzip或Brotli进行页面压缩,这种方法可以直接作用于HTML、CSS、JavaScript等代码文件,进一步优化网页加载速度。
-
动态生成内容:
对于一些动态生成的内容,如数据库查询结果,可以通过预计算并缓存的方式,避免频繁的数据库调用,从而减少服务器的压力和响应时间。
虚拟主机上的网页压缩是一个综合性的解决方案,不仅能够显著提升用户的访问体验,还能有效地管理服务器资源,降低运营成本,通过对网站进行全面优化,企业不仅能吸引更多访客,也能在未来市场竞争中占据有利位置,这也是一个持续改进的过程,随着时间的推移和技术的发展,还有更多创新的方案等待我们去探索和实践。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库